The Basic Troubleshooting Steps are:
Restart..  Reset..  Restore from Backup..  Restore as New...
Try this First... You will Not Lose Any Data...
Turn the Phone Off... ( if it isn’t already )
Press and Hold the Sleep/Wake Button and the Home Button at the Same Time...
Wait for the Apple logo to Appear and then Disappear...
Usually takes about 15 - 20 Seconds... (But can take Longer...)
Release the Buttons...
Turn the Phone On...
If you cannot Resolve your Issue... Then a Restore would be the way to go...

    Most of the current Apple Intel based computers are comparable in CPU speed. I don't think it is so much the model of laptop as it is the memory, and storage capacity of the machine. If you are going to use FCP on a regular basis, perhaps as a professional or semi-professional, then you should think about the maximum memory and a very large capacity internal disk drive. For instance, one hour of finished compressed video will take up about 1.5 to 2Gbytes of disk space. If you add up the raw footage and still imagery and audio, you'll use up your disk drive capacity real quick. So a hard disk on the order of 750Gbytes @ 7200rpms might be good for video editing. 5400RPMs might be slow to rendering times. Rendering a video might take up a lot of memory so more memory is better e.g. 8Gbytes.
    As a rule of thumb, once you get to about 80% of your disk drive or memory you'll see degradation of performance.
    You can check out macsales.com. THey have a menu system that will allow you to pick and choose from various alternatives. BTW, it's been said that although Macs are typically spec'd at a certain memory size, macsales.com found that Apple computers will actually support higher memory levels. That is, if 4Gbytes are spec'd, some machines support 6Gbytes. macsales.com will provide the guidance for you.
    You might also consider buying an external disk e.g. 500Gbytes to carry around with you for back-up or transport to another machine.
